The Media Composer Editing Essentails (MC101) course is the first step in achieving confidence, creativity, and efficiency with Avid Media Composer, the non-linear film/video editing application used in most movie and television productions. Together with the second course in the series, Media Composer Effects Essentials, this course provides the foundational training required to achieve the credential of Avid Certified User | Media Composer.

Media Composer Editing Essentials will get you editing right away with a built-in Quick Start guide covering the essential tools you need to start a basic project, assemble the story, and output to web — perfect for producers, journalists and corporate videographers. For those headed toward a career in post production, the second half of the course builds on the Quick Start to offer complete, foundational training in the craft of professional editing for news and documentary, commercial spots, and scripted narrative films.

Learn by doing with real-world projects. Starting with the basics of 3-point editing and how to construct a scene, then moving on to reworking a scene and trimming dialogue for maximum emotional impact. Add to that the tools and techniques to mix music and sound effects, create titles and transitions, and deliver the program to specification. You will also learn critical skills needed to work as an assistant editor, including how to sync picture and sound from different sources, organize a project, manage media and metadata, and more.

The Media Composer Effects Essentials (MC110) course is for video editors who understand the basics of the editing tools in Media Composer and are ready to move ahead and learn the fundamentals of creating effects within Avid Media Composer, the non-linear film/video editing application used in most movie and television productions. This course provides a solid foundation in Media Composer video effects capabilities and in conjunction with the Media Composer Editing Essentials (MC110) course, will prepare you to earn the credential of Avid Certified User | Media Composer.

Firstly, you will be taken through the basic effects-building interface and learn the mechanics of working with effects in Media Composer. Then, using real-world examples, you will learn to solve common video image and editing problems using effects, like tracking and stabilization; create multi-layered effects; use various retiming methods; create pan-and-zoom style effects with Ultra HD images, use automated color correction tools to fix exposure and color problems; and more.
